2025 Model Comparisons

When evaluating these models for 2025, it’s important to weigh both performance and overall driving experience.

Power & Efficiency Breakdown

Gasoline Models

  • The Toyota RAV4 comes with a 2.5L engine generating 203hp, boasting a fuel consumption rate of 8.1L/100km, making it a steady performer in everyday conditions.

  • The Honda CR-V, equipped with a 1.5T engine delivering 190hp, has a slightly higher consumption at 8.4L/100km, which might appeal to those who prioritize a balance between performance and efficiency.

Hybrid Performance

RAV4’s dual motor all-wheel-drive system accelerates faster, reaching 0-100km/h in 7.3 seconds, roughly 14% quicker than the CR-V hybrid variant’s 8.1 seconds. This difference highlights the RAV4’s enhanced hybrid capabilities and fuel efficiency, a key aspect if you often face city traffic or long commutes.

Maintenance Costs (First 5 Years)

When budgeting for your vehicle, considering maintenance is vital. Below is a comparative glance at expected costs over the first five years:

Expense

Toyota RAV4

Honda CR-V

Scheduled Checks

AED 3,200 / SAR 3,200

AED 4,100 / SAR 4,100

Brake Pads

AED 850 / SAR 850

AED 1,100 / SAR 1,100

Hybrid Battery

10-year warranty

8-year warranty

These costs suggest the RAV4 might offer lower long-term ownership expenses, while the CR-V emphasizes technological comfort and advanced safety features. Integrating these details can help you plan your maintenance budget effectively.
